The role
We are seeking to appoint a Faculty Librarian to support the Faculty of Engineering and Physical Sciences, who will join our wider team working to create strong partnerships and relationships between the Faculty and Library and Learning Services.

In this role, you will be the key point of contact for supporting academics with teaching and learning activities, collection development and management alongside supporting the research culture by delivering support, guidance and training for research staff and PGRs.

Working closely with colleagues in our Content, Open Research and Learning Development teams you will play a key role in the Library's offering at the University as well as working with many departments around the institution.

You will play a significant role in shaping the innovative development of Library support for academic activity.

About you
We are looking for an enthusiastic, collaborative and adaptable professional who has experience in an academic environment and can demonstrate a passion for fostering learning, promoting and delivering research skills and knowledge-sharing.

You will be able to demonstrate excellent communication skills, and will be someone who enjoys collaborating with different teams to deliver high quality and user-centred services to our diverse university community.

You will have strong digital skills, be excited about using new tools and technologies and be committed to staying current with the latest trends in academic libraries as well has having an commitment to your own on-going development.

An understanding of the current Higher Education landscape for information provision is essential and experience of subjects within the Faculty would be an advantage.

You will also be able to demonstrate a clear commitment to diversity and inclusion.

There is an expectation that the post holder will work some days on campus and that they will be able to support colleagues across the team as needed.
